What is recorded here

Terraced three-bay three-storey house, extant 1840, on a rectangular plan with shopfront to ground floor. For sale, 2005. Pitched slate roof with clay ridge tiles, and replacement uPVC rainwater goods on rendered eaves retaining cast-iron downpipes. Rendered, ruled and lined wall to front (west) elevation. Timber shopfront to ground floor. Square-headed window openings in tripartite arrangement (north) with cut-granite sills, timber mullions, and concealed dressings framing nine-over-six (first floor) or six-over-six (top floor) timber sash windows having three-over-two (first floor) or two-over-two (top floor) sidelights. Square-headed window openings (south) with cut-granite sills, and concealed dressings framing nine-over-six (first floor) or six-over-six (top floor) timber sash windows. Street fronted with concrete footpath to front.
